Really annoying connection
My step dad connected us up to Sky about 2 months ago, and there was a disconnecting problems for a few weeks. Then it stopped for a bit, and about 2 weeks ago it started again. But the thing is, I seem to be the only one affected. Both my Mum and Step Dad use it with ease, but my internet can be fine for about 1 or 2 hours, then it decides to keep disconnecting every 3 minutes or so. I wouldn't mind this usually, but I play a game which requires you to be online for more than a couple of minutes to get somewhere successfully. It always seems to disconnect at the times when I'm doing something important on the game. But I really don't know what is wrong with it... I am further away from the router, but even when the signal is good is disconnects.

Re: Really annoying connection
That's the problem with wireless - it is very unreliable. It's the signal strength that is being reported which is not the same as signal quality (which is the more important factor).
You'd be much better off with ethernet but assuming that you have to use wireless, there are a few things you can do:
- try experimenting with small changes to the router/aerial orientation
- Try experimenting with different wireless channels
- make sure the router is off the ground and away from any electrical devices, particularly wireless phones, video senders etc

That's interesting - I've never heard of a regular 3 minute disconnect before (UPnP can be every 16 minutes and that's the only regular disconnection cause I know of).
The other poster is wireless and the problem isn't affecting the other users on the LAN. That to me suggests it's not the router or a line problem (and maybe not wireless) so I wonder if there is some similar problem with the PC set up? Power saving or something like that maybe? Driver conflict? Vista?
